Lapat, also known as laphet or lahpet, is a fermented tea leaf dish that is a national delicacy of Myanmar. The preparation of lapat involves a meticulous process of fermenting young tea leaves, which can take anywhere from a few weeks to several months. This fermentation gives the leaves a distinctive sour and slightly pungent flavor, along with a tender texture.
